Plaster Molder First Shift
Summary/Objective
Responsible for weighing and mixing plaster and subsequently pouring it into a mold.
Job Responsibilities
- Weighs plaster and water and mixes together
- Pours plaster mix into mold
- Uses strike off bar to level plaster with top of mold
- Strips molds, removes flask, visually inspects, removes flash and makes minor repairs
- Loads molds into ovens
- Clean molds and flasks
